What is Blade_Fix02.net.dll?
A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is like a special toolbox that contains code and data that multiple programs can use. These files help the programs run smoothly and also save disk space by allowing different programs to share the same resources. For Blade_Fix02.net.dll, it specifically helps the game Grand Theft Auto: Episodes from Liberty City to work better by providing additional functionality or fixing certain issues within the game.

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ility
In this guide, we will explain how to use the Check Disk Utility to fix Blade_Fix02.net.dll errors.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Command Prompt
in the search bar and press Enter. -
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.
-
In the Command Prompt window, type
chkdsk /f
and press Enter. -
If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type
Y
and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.
-
If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.
